  • Tekαkαpimək Contact Station Visit

    Age group: Youth entering 6th through 11th grades. Spend the day exploring Tekαkαpimək Contact Station, a one-of-a-kind space shaped through collaboration between the National Park Service and Wabanaki communities. Students will explore interactive exhibits, stories, and artwork that highlight Indigenous history, culture, and connections to this landscape. Open to students entering grades 6-11.
